BTL School and College of Nursing Cutoff Criteria

General Nursing and Midwifery (GNM)

Eligibility Criteria:

  • At BTL Nursing College, Typically, candidates need a minimum of 40% to 50% marks in their 10+2 examinations. The exact cutoff percentage may fluctuate based on the academic year and the number of applicants.

  • Specific cutoffs are generally announced closer to the application deadline and can vary yearly.

Admission Process:

  • At BTL Nursing College, Candidates must meet the minimum cutoff to be considered for admission. Selection might also involve an entrance exam or an interview, depending on the college’s guidelines.

Important Note:

  • Subjects: No specific subject requirements, but a background in science is often preferred

Additional Criteria:

  • Entrance Exam/Interview: Some years may include an entrance examination or interview as part of the selection process, Meeting the cutoff marks is essential for moving forward in this stage.

Bachelor of Science in Nursing (B.Sc. Nursing)

Eligibility Criteria:

  • A minimum of 45% marks in 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ology is usually required. The B.sc cutoff can be influenced by the overall performance of applicants and the number of seats available.

  • Cutoff marks are typically set after reviewing the application pool and may be published in the admission notifications.

Admission Process:

  • Candidates who meet the cutoff are usually invited to an entrance test or interview. Performance in these assessments can also play a role in the final selection.

Important Note:

  • The cutoff may vary each year based on competition and other factors.

  • Stream: Candidates must have completed their 10+2 with the science stream.

Additional Criteria:

  • Entrance Exam/Interview: Performance in an entrance test or interview might influence final admission decisions. Cutoff marks are set based on the overall applicant performance.

BTL School and College of Nursing Eligibility Criteria - Post Basic B.Sc. Nursing

Eligibility Criteria:

  • Candidates need to have completed a General Nursing and Midwifery (GNM) course and be registered with a valid nursing license. The cutoff is typically based on academic records and might include other criteria like work experience

Admission Process:

  • Admission is often granted based on academic performance in the GNM course, and there may be an interview or an entrance test.

Important Note

  • The BTL Nursing cutoff for this program may vary based on the number of applicants and available seats.

  • Registration: Must be registered with a nursing council or board.

Additional Criteria:

  • Work Experience: Some programs may require relevant work experience in the nursing field.

  • Interview/Assessment: An interview or assessment may be conducted to evaluate the candidate’s suitability for the program.

Master of Science in Nursing (M.Sc. Nursing)

Eligibility Criteria:

  • A minimum of 55% marks in B.Sc. Nursing or Post Basic B.Sc. Nursing is generally required. 

Admission Process:

  • Candidates who meet the cutoff may be required to take an entrance examination or participate in an interview. Admission decisions are influenced by both academic performance and these assessments.

Important Note

  • Higher cutoff percentages may be applied depending on the program’s demand and the quality of applicants.

  • Course Completion: The degree must be from a recognized institution.

Additional Criteria:

  • Entrance Exam/Interview: Admission may be based on performance in an entrance examination or interview. The cutoff for this program is influenced by the competition and the quality of applicants

Auxiliary Nursing and Midwifery (ANM)

Eligibility Criteria:

  • At BTL Nursing College, Candidates must have at least 40% marks in their 10+2 examinations. The specific cutoff percentage may be adjusted based on the number of applicants and other factors.

Admission Process:

  • Meeting the cutoff is essential for admission. An entrance test or interview might be conducted as part of the selection process.

Important Note:

  • Cutoff marks for ANM programs are generally lower compared to other nursing courses, but they can still vary each year.

Additional Criteria:

  • Entrance Exam/Interview for ANM: Some years may include an entrance exam or interview as part of the selection process.

BTL School and College of Nursing Cutoff - 5-Year Statistics

To provide a comprehensive view of admission trends at BTL School and College of Nursing, it is helpful to review the cutoff statistics over the past five years. ​

General Nursing and Midwifery (GNM)

Academic Year

Minimum Cutoff (%)

Details

2019-2020

45%

Based on overall academic performance and applicant volume.

2020-2021

48%

Small gain due to a more increased number of students.

2021-2022

47%

Adjusted based on competition and seat availability.

2022-2023

50%

Increased cutoff reflecting higher competition.

2023-2024

49%

Moderately high cutoff, adjusted for new applicant trends.

Bachelor of Science in Nursing (B.Sc. Nursing)

Academic Year

Minimum Cutoff (%)

Details

2019-2020

50%

Standard cutoff based on applicant academic performance.

2020-2021

52%

Higher cutoff due to increased applicant numbers.

2021-2022

51%

Adjusted to balance demand and supply.

2022-2023

54%

Reflects higher competition and overall performance.

2023-2024

53%

Stable with a slight decrease in competition.

Post Basic B.Sc. Nursing

Academic Year

Minimum Cutoff (%)

Details

2019-2020

55%

Based on GNM performance and other criteria.

2020-2021

57%

Increased cutoff reflecting more competitive entry.

2021-2022

56%

Adjusted to match applicant quality and number.

2022-2023

58%

Higher cutoff due to high performance among applicants.

2023-2024

56%

Moderately high, aligning with applicant trends.

Master of Science in Nursing (M.Sc. Nursing)

Academic Year

Minimum Cutoff (%)

Details

2019-2020

60%

Standard cutoff for advanced studies.

2020-2021

62%

Grown due to a rise in applicant quality.

2021-2022

61%

Adjusted based on competitive landscape.

2022-2023

64%

Reflects high competition and applicant performance.

2023-2024

63%

Slight decrease with the stable competition.

Auxiliary Nursing and Midwifery (ANM)

Academic Year

Minimum Cutoff (%)

Details

2019-2020

40%

Entry-level cutoff for the ANM program.

2020-2021

42%

Increased slightly due to higher demand.

2021-2022

41%

Adjusted based on available seats and applicant pool.

2022-2023

43%

Reflects a moderate rise in the cutoff.

2023-2024

42%

Stable with slight adjustments for new trends.

How to Interpret Cutoff Trends

  • Variations in Cutoff Percentages: Cutoff percentages can vary each year based on factors such as the number of applicants, their academic performance, and changes in program demand.

  • Impact of Competition: Higher cutoffs often indicate increased competition among applicants or a rise in the quality of applicants.

  • Institutional Decisions: Adjustments in cutoffs can also be influenced by institutional policies, changes in program structure, and other internal factors.
